Latest Global CVEs

CVE-2026-16174
SUMMARY

Netskope was notified about a potential gap in Netskope Endpoint DLP (EPDLP) running on Windows systems. Successful exploitation of the gap could potentially allow a privileged user to send a crafted message to the EPDLP process port to trigger an integer overflow, leading to memory corruption. Successful exploitation would require the EPDLP module to be enabled in the client configuration, and that Memory Integrity is disabled. A successful exploit could potentially result in a denial-of-service, arbitrary code execution, or privilege escalation on the local machine.

CVE-2026-16172
SUMMARY

Netskope was notified of an out-of-bounds heap read affecting the Endpoint DLP (EPDLP) service of the Netskope Client. A local standard user could potentially send a specially crafted message that is not properly validated with a bounds check, likely crashing the kernel driver handler. Successful exploitation could potentially crash the EPDLP service, temporarily interrupting DLP enforcement. A successful exploit could potentially also reveal per-boot memory layout information to unauthorized users.

CVE-2026-87958
SUMMARY

IBM Db2 11.5.0 through 11.5.9, and 12.1.0 through 12.1.5 is vulnerable to a denial of service where a specific functionality on a Db2 server can be disabled by a privileged user under certain conditions.

CVE-2026-86093
SUMMARY

IBM Db2 11.5.0 through 11.5.9, and 12.1.0 through 12.1.5 could allow an attacker with the ability to control or impersonate a DRDA server endpoint to execute arbitrary commands on Db2 clients due to a stack-based buffer overflow that improperly copies user-controlled data into a fixed-size stack buffer without bounds checking.
